安装winidows server 2016最低内存要求?

安装Windows Server 2016的最低内存要求是512 MB。然而,这个最低要求仅适用于极少数特定场景下的最小化安装(如核心安装),并不适合大多数实际生产环境中的使用。对于大多数用户和企业来说,建议至少配备4 GB的内存,以确保系统的稳定性和性能。

分析与探讨

最低要求的背景

微软官方文档中明确规定,Windows Server 2016的最低内存要求为512 MB。这一数值主要针对的是那些只需要运行最基本操作系统功能的场景,例如用于测试或开发环境的核心安装版本。在这种情况下,系统只提供最基础的服务和支持,用户界面非常简化,甚至没有图形界面,所有操作都需要通过命令行完成。

实际应用中的需求

在实际应用中,特别是对于企业级服务器而言,512 MB的内存远远不够。现代服务器通常需要运行多个服务、应用程序以及管理工具,这些都会占用大量的内存资源。为了保证系统的响应速度、稳定性和可靠性,4 GB是一个更为合理的起点。

  • 虚拟化环境:如果你打算在Windows Server 2016上运行Hyper-V或其他虚拟化平台,那么4 GB的内存几乎是必不可少的。每个虚拟机本身也需要一定的内存分配,因此总内存需求会进一步增加。

  • 数据库服务器:SQL Server等数据库管理系统对内存的要求较高,尤其是在处理大量数据时。充足的内存可以显著提高查询性能和并发处理能力。

  • 文件和打印服务:虽然这些服务相对轻量,但在高负载环境下,它们仍然需要足够的内存来保持高效运行。

推荐配置

对于一般的企业级应用,建议将内存配置提升到8 GB或更高。这样不仅可以确保操作系统本身的流畅运行,还能为各种附加服务和应用程序留出足够的空间。特别是在多任务处理或多用户环境中,更多的内存意味着更好的用户体验和更高的工作效率。

内存不足的影响

如果服务器的内存低于推荐值,可能会导致以下问题:

  • 性能下降:系统频繁进行磁盘交换(即页换入换出),这会极大地拖慢整体性能。
  • 稳定性问题:某些关键进程可能因为内存不足而崩溃,进而影响整个系统的稳定性。
  • 资源争用:多个应用程序和服务之间争夺有限的内存资源,可能导致不可预测的行为。

综上所述,尽管Windows Server 2016的最低内存要求仅为512 MB,但为了确保系统的正常运作和最佳性能,建议至少配备4 GB的内存。这对于绝大多数应用场景来说都是一个较为合理的选择。